Saturday, December 21, 7PM – “An Ozark Winter Solstice.”

December 18, 2024 by Fawn Smith

Join us for an evening Winter Solstice celebration as we welcome back the return of light. We will honor our heritage, Ozark traditions, and this special time of year with merriment and singing. This is a family-friendly service, and all are invited to stay for the finger-food potluck after the service!
